Jason Maxwell and Angela Montana are trappin fools!  They each trapped their first raccoons of their lives and of the season last week.

BeFunky_SAM_1064.jpgJason, VP West of the Montana Trappers Association, ended up with a large-medium coon hide that was stretched to 24-inches, after being skinned, while Angela Montana’s coon hide ended up being in the 3XL category at 33-inches.  Toby Walrath, the President of the Montana Trappers Association, showed the newbie trappers how to skin the animals and prepare the hide to sell at a fur sale.  Angela Montana, however, changed her mind, early on, and decided to turn hers into a coonskin hat, rather than sell the hide.

It was a messy job, but they got it done!  Angela Montana even ended up keeping one of the hands to turn into a ceiling fan pull chain thingamabob…which might be a little weird, but she is still pretty stoked about it.
